Rybakova, T. V. Semiotic aspect of studying modern cultural texts

Abstract: Resume: the article is devoted to semiotics as one of the most effective methods of studying modern cultural texts. The author views culture as a very complex system of signs and it allows him to apply semiotic analysis to all kinds of cultural objects. According to the author, the process of “semiotizaton” of human studies, which has been quite intensive in the last decades, is mainly conditioned by changes occurring in the status of modern semiotics. Applying methods of structural linguistics to cultural objects has enabled the author to define an “ideological program” and to show how it works, how it structures itself and how it influences other cultural practices. The article has a mostly methodological significance.
